Wool: The Ancient Fiber Making a Serious Modern Comeback

Wool, long associated with scratchy, uncomfortable garments, is experiencing a major comeback as a high-performance, sustainable natural fiber. Modern wool, particularly merino, offers exceptional breathability, moisture-wicking, and temperature regulation, surpassing many synthetic alternatives. Taming the Digital Deluge: How to Keep Your Eyes (and Style) Intact

Our digital lives are essential but hard on our eyes. Blue light from screens can disrupt sleep and cause digital eye strain. Thankfully, stylish blue light blocking glasses, like those from IZIPIZI, offer protection without sacrificing style, making them a modern necessity. Beyond eyewear, adopting better digital habits—taking breaks, adjusting screen settings, and prioritizing sleep hygiene—is key to overall digital wellness. Sanuk: Beyond the Blisters, Into Pure Bliss

Sanuk isn't just about footwear; it's a lifestyle brand championing comfort and a relaxed approach to life. Founded by surfer Jeff Kelly, the brand's philosophy of "Happy Shoes, Happy Feet" is evident in their innovative designs, like the iconic yoga mat sandals. Sanuk prioritizes foot-hugging footbeds, soft uppers, flexible construction, and lightweight materials to ensure all-day comfort. Beyond their signature comfort, Sanuk offers a versatile range of styles suitable for various occasions, often featuring vibrant designs that allow personal expression. The brand also demonstrates a commitment to sustainability through the use of recycled materials and eco-friendly practices, alongside supporting various charitable causes. Whether seeking beach-ready sandals or comfortable everyday wear, Sanuk provides options for everyone, encouraging wearers to embrace everyday adventures with happy, well-supported feet.
